I went web searching for the 3TTT Mutant and could not find that particular model. A lot of 3TTT bars are lightweight racing bars that will not last as long as a heavier bar. You gave no indication as to how old the bars are, if these are an older model (thus the reason I could not find them) then they may have just got to fatigued (aluminum does that). Most ultrarlight (racing) AL bar manufactures recommend replacing the bars every 2 years if racing or do hard climbing.
